LAURIE T. FREED
Artistic Director
Laurie is a Los Angeles and Washington, D.C. award winning theatre actress and director. With Master Degrees in Theatre and Drama Therapy, Laurie has over 30 years experience as a theatrical performer, director, college professor and therapist. As a founding member of Peace Mountain Theatre Company and the force behind it, Laurie directed the inaugural production of COLLECTED STORIES, ALL MY SONS, A DELICATE BALANCE and A SHAYNA MAIDEL. She initiated our Educational Outreach Program and directed programs on Bullying and The Opioid Crisis.
PERI SCHUYLER
Vice President
Peri spent more than twenty-five years in the field of medical database management and thesaurus development. A devoted theater-goer for many years, she broke into the working side of theater as Stage Manager for PMTC's production of COLLECTED STORIES and other PMTC Productions. She was Board Secretary 2016-2018 and Research Analyst in 2019.
AARON AUERBACH
Treasurer
Aaron Auerbach MD MPH FCAP (Treasurer) is a world renowned hematopathologist with over 150 publications as well as an ardent supporter of the fine arts. He served as treasurer of the Wyngate Elementary School PTA 2017-2019. His goal with Peace Mountain Theatre Company is to achieve financial growth and stability while supporting the Peace Mountain community. He holds a Medical Degree from Robert Wood Johnson Medical School, a Master's in Public Health for Health Care Administration at Rutgers University as well as a Bachelo in Science in Accounting and a Bachelor of Arts in English.
JACQUELINE YOUM
Director
Jacqueline Youm is the newest member of our Board of Directors. Jacqueline is a Senegalese-American actor, lawyer, and French/English/Spanish teacher. She also coaches mediation and negotiation at American University Washington College of Law from which she also graduated. Jacqueline has been acting and writing poetry, monologues, and plays for several years.
